Full job description

Job Description

The Head of Production leads the production function for GM’s Global Visualization Studio (GVS). This role designs and runs the operating model for how work moves through the studio across brands and pillars – from intake to delivery.

Sitting alongside the Head of Creative, the Head of Production is accountable for how projects are planned, staffed, scheduled, reviewed, and delivered, and for ensuring that GVS operates as one integrated studio in partnership with Design, Marketing, and Asset Foundations. This position manages the producer layer, sets production standards and rhythms, and is responsible for speed, cost, and production quality across all GVS outputs.

What You’ll Do

  • Define and lead the end-to-end production model for GVS across all brands and pillars (Creative Operations, Production/Design/Systems/Data, Architecture & Experience).

  • Establish and maintain a shared intake and prioritization process with Design and Marketing so there is a single front door and a clear view of what matters most.

  • Design and enforce simple, repeatable workflows for planning, reviews, approvals, and delivery.

  • Lead, coach, and develop a team of producers and production leads aligned by brand and workstream.

  • Partner closely with the Head of Creative, pillar leads, and Brand Liaisons to ensure creative and production leadership are tightly coordinated.

  • Drive a culture of accountability, transparency, and continuous improvement within the production function.

  • Oversee production planning, schedules, and resource allocation across live action, CGI/retouching, visualization design, systems, data, and architecture teams.

  • Work with producers and pillar leads to ensure the right skills are on the right projects at the right time, including coordination with satellite studios (Pasadena, UK, China, Korea).

  • Balance internal capacity with external partners (agencies, vendors) where appropriate, based on cost, quality, and timing.

  • Own the production use of shared tools (e.g., Monday.com, Frame.io, Google Workspace) so status, ownership, and next steps are visible and predictable.

  • Help define and operationalize self-serve tools and pipelines that enable repeatable work (evergreen, pack shots, adaptations) at scale.

  • Set and uphold production standards for quality, timeliness, and efficiency across all GVS outputs.

  • Track and report on key production metrics (throughput, rework, cost avoidance, on-time delivery) and use those insights to refine the model.

  • Work with Design and Marketing partners to identify opportunities to insource or shift work into GVS where it improves quality, consistency, or cost-effectiveness.

Your Skills & Abilities (Required Qualifications)

  • Bachelor’s degree in a relevant field (e.g., Film/TV Production, Design, Communications, Business) or equivalent experience.

  • 10+ years of experience in production leadership roles within creative, visualization, or content-driven organizations (e.g., agency, studio, in-house brand side).

  • Demonstrated experience managing producers and/or managers across multiple concurrent projects and disciplines.

  • Proven track record designing and running production processes at scale (from intake to delivery).

What Will Give You A Competitive Edge (Preferred Qualifications)

  • Experience in automotive, visualization, or design-driven environments is strongly preferred.

  • Prior experience bridging in-house studios and external agencies/vendors.

  • Working knowledge of live action, CGI/retouching, VFX/3D, and/or real-time visualization workflows.

  • Familiarity with project/production tools such as Monday.com, Frame.io, and modern asset pipelines (MMM/UDM, Unreal/WebGL, or similar).

  • Demonstrated success leading change and building new teams or capabilities within a complex organization.
